Confirmed Exoplanet Discovered 2009

11 UMi b

A gas giant orbiting the k-type orange 11 UMi, located approximately 408.7 light-years from Earth.

Key parameters at a glance

  • A radius of 12.30 Earth radii
  • A mass of 4,684.81 Earth masses
  • Surface gravity around 30.97 g
  • An orbital period of 516.220 days
  • Semi-major axis 1.5300 AU
  • Distance from Earth 408.74 light-years
  • Earth Similarity Index 0.332
  • Travel time at Voyager 1 speed 7,208,164 years
